In this article, you’ll learn how to add the Social Follow element to your Thrive Theme Builder templates so visitors can find and follow your social media profiles.
What Is the Social Follow Element?
The Social Follow element displays clickable icons that link to your brand’s social media profiles (Facebook, Twitter/X, Instagram, LinkedIn, YouTube, etc.). Unlike the Author Social Links element (which shows per-author social profiles), the Social Follow element displays your site-wide social accounts—the same profiles on every page.
Adding the Social Follow Element

- Open a template in the Thrive Theme Builder editor.
- Click the plus (+) icon in the right sidebar.
- Search for Social Follow.
- Drag the element into position on the template.
Recommended Placements
- Footer — The most common location. Visitors expect to find social links in the footer.
- Header — For prominent social media visibility on every page.
- Sidebar — As a secondary navigation element alongside other sidebar content.
- About the Author area — Below the author box for additional social context.
Configuring the Element
After placing the Social Follow element, select it to see its options in the left sidebar:
Social Networks
Choose which social media platforms to display. Add or remove networks from the element’s configuration. Common options include:
- X (formerly Twitter)
- YouTube
Each network’s icon links to the URL you specify.
Style and Appearance
- Icon style — Choose from multiple pre-designed icon styles (solid, outline, rounded, etc.).
- Size — Adjust the icon size.
- Spacing — Control the gap between icons.
- Colors — Use brand colors or custom colors for each icon.
- Alignment — Set the alignment of the icon row (left, center, right).
Social Follow vs. Author Social Links
| Feature | Social Follow | Author Social Links |
|---|---|---|
| Scope | Site-wide (your brand’s accounts) | Per-author (individual author’s accounts) |
| Content | Same on every page | Changes based on post author |
| Typical placement | Footer, header, sidebar | Inside the About the Author box |
| Use case | Brand promotion | Reader-author connection |
Use Social Follow when you want visitors to follow your brand’s social media. Use Author Social Links when you want readers to connect with the specific author of a post.
Best Practices
- Include 3–5 platforms — Display only the social networks where you’re most active. Too many icons can look cluttered.
- Keep links updated — Make sure all social profile URLs are correct and point to active accounts.
- Use recognizable icons — Stick with standard icon styles that visitors will immediately recognize.
- Place in the footer at minimum — Even if you add social icons elsewhere, always include them in the footer for visitors who scroll to the bottom.
- Match your brand — Customize icon colors to complement your template design while keeping them recognizable.
